The Historical Roots: Shared Experiences and Shifting Alliances

Alright, let's rewind the clock a bit and check out the history books. The relationship between China and Russia isn't just a recent thing; it's got roots that go way back. Think about the Cold War era, when both countries were on the same side, ideologically aligned against the West. This shared experience of facing off against the United States and its allies played a massive role in shaping their early bond. They shared a common ideology, communism, which acted like a strong glue, sticking them together in the face of a world that often saw them as threats.

However, things weren't always smooth sailing. There were times when tensions flared, particularly during the Sino-Soviet split in the 1960s. This was a major rift, fueled by ideological differences and national interests, and it led to a period of frosty relations and even border skirmishes. It's a reminder that even allies can have their spats!

Fast forward to the post-Cold War era. With the collapse of the Soviet Union, both countries had to navigate a new world order. Russia, facing economic hardship and a perceived decline in global influence, began to see China as a potential partner. Meanwhile, China, experiencing rapid economic growth, saw Russia as a source of resources, technology, and, importantly, a strategic ally to balance against the dominance of the United States. This convergence of interests laid the groundwork for a renewed and strengthened relationship. And as the world changed, both China and Russia found themselves facing similar challenges and opportunities, further solidifying their partnership. They realized that working together could amplify their influence and navigate the complexities of the 21st century more effectively. Economic Ties: A Symbiotic Relationship

Let's talk money, baby! Economic cooperation is a massive pillar of the China-Russia relationship. It's a relationship that benefits both countries, and that's the bottom line. Think of it as a bit of a symbiotic dance. China needs resources, and Russia has them in abundance. Russia needs markets, and China's got the biggest in the world.

Trade between the two nations has boomed in recent years. China is now Russia's biggest trading partner, and Russia is a major supplier of oil and gas to China. This trade isn't just about raw materials; it also includes manufactured goods, technology, and investment. Both countries have been working hard to diversify their trade and reduce their dependence on the West, which has made them more resistant to economic pressures from other countries.

Energy is a huge factor. Russia is a major player in the global energy market, and China's insatiable demand for energy makes it a crucial customer. Pipelines and other infrastructure projects have been built to ensure a steady flow of oil and gas from Russia to China. This partnership helps both countries secure their energy supplies and reduce their vulnerability to external shocks.

Investment is another key element. Chinese companies are investing heavily in Russia's infrastructure and natural resources, while Russian companies are investing in China's growing economy. These investments are helping to modernize Russia's economy and provide China with access to valuable resources and technologies. Strategic Alignment: A United Front?

Now, let's get into the nitty-gritty of their strategic alignment. This is where things get really interesting. China and Russia often find themselves on the same side of the table when it comes to international politics. They share a vision of a multipolar world, where power is more evenly distributed and not dominated by a single superpower, like the United States. This shared vision drives them to work together in international forums like the United Nations, where they often vote in tandem and block Western-led initiatives.

Military Cooperation is another crucial aspect. The two countries regularly hold joint military exercises, which are designed to improve their interoperability and demonstrate their commitment to mutual defense. These exercises send a clear signal to the rest of the world that China and Russia are serious about defending their interests. They have also been strengthening their military technology cooperation, with Russia supplying advanced weapons systems to China.

Geopolitical Considerations play a massive role. Both China and Russia are wary of what they see as Western interference in their internal affairs. They see NATO expansion and the rise of Western influence in their respective spheres of influence as a threat. This shared concern helps to cement their strategic alignment and encourages them to cooperate on issues like cybersecurity and counterterrorism.

Challenges and Potential Pitfalls: Navigating a Complex Terrain

Okay, guys, let's not paint a rosy picture. Even with all the cooperation, the China-Russia relationship isn't without its challenges and potential pitfalls. It's a complex dance, and there are a few things that could trip them up along the way. First off, there's the power imbalance. China is the rising economic powerhouse, and Russia, while still a major player, is playing catch-up. This power dynamic could lead to tensions down the road, as China's influence grows and Russia's relative power diminishes. It's like having a best friend who is getting more popular than you – it can be a bit tricky to navigate.

Differing Priorities also pose a challenge. While they agree on many things, China and Russia don't always see eye-to-eye on every issue. They have their own national interests to consider, and those interests don't always align perfectly. Think of it like this: you and your friend might both like pizza, but you might disagree on what toppings to get. It's not a deal-breaker, but it can lead to some lively discussions.

Then there's the risk of over-reliance. Russia is increasingly dependent on China for economic support, and China, in turn, is reliant on Russia for energy and resources. This interdependence is a double-edged sword. It strengthens their bond, but it also makes them vulnerable to external shocks or changes in the global landscape. Imagine putting all your eggs in one basket – if something happens to that basket, you're in trouble.

Finally, there's the potential for external pressure. The West, particularly the United States, sees the China-Russia partnership as a challenge to its global dominance. This could lead to sanctions, diplomatic pressure, and other measures aimed at disrupting their cooperation. Both countries need to be prepared for the possibility of external interference, which could make their relationship even more challenging.
